реклама на сайте
подробности

 
 
> Программа для прошивки AVR, через JTAGICE MKII
shreck
сообщение Aug 14 2012, 08:23
Сообщение #1


Местный
***

Группа: Свой
Сообщений: 327
Регистрация: 24-06-06
Из: Томск
Пользователь №: 18 328



Добрый день.
Задаю вопрос по просьбе коллеги по работе.

Есть atmel'овское изделие AVR JTAGICE MKII. Нужна удобная программа (можно гуевую, можно консольную) для прошивки своих изделий при производстве. Чем можно воспользоватья?
Go to the top of the page
 
+Quote Post
2 страниц V   1 2 >  
Start new topic
Ответов (1 - 14)
Lotor
сообщение Aug 14 2012, 08:30
Сообщение #2


Местный
***

Группа: Свой
Сообщений: 476
Регистрация: 3-07-07
Из: Санкт-Петербург
Пользователь №: 28 866



Я для нашего производства писал свою оболочку, которая в фоне работает с avrdude


--------------------
Ковырял чукча отверткой в ухе, звук в телевизоре и пропал.
Go to the top of the page
 
+Quote Post
shreck
сообщение Aug 14 2012, 09:28
Сообщение #3


Местный
***

Группа: Свой
Сообщений: 327
Регистрация: 24-06-06
Из: Томск
Пользователь №: 18 328



Цитата(Lotor @ Aug 14 2012, 15:30) *
Я для нашего производства писал свою оболочку, которая в фоне работает с avrdude

На первый взгяд AVRDUDE подходит. Будем пробовать.
Go to the top of the page
 
+Quote Post
demiurg_spb
сообщение Aug 14 2012, 10:04
Сообщение #4


неотягощённый злом
******

Группа: Свой
Сообщений: 2 746
Регистрация: 31-01-08
Из: Санкт-Петербург
Пользователь №: 34 643



Цитата(Lotor @ Aug 14 2012, 12:30) *
Я для нашего производства писал свою оболочку, которая в фоне работает с avrdude

Аналогично.
Но как-то ИМХО жалко для производства JTAG-ICE использовать...
У нас используется аналог stk200 с нормальным мягеньким шлейфиком. И всё-равно иногда приходится его переобжимать и менять из-за сильного использования.
Мне кажется что JTAG-ICE тоже долго не протянет.


--------------------
“Будьте внимательны к своим мыслям - они начало поступков” (Лао-Цзы)
Go to the top of the page
 
+Quote Post
shreck
сообщение Aug 14 2012, 10:56
Сообщение #5


Местный
***

Группа: Свой
Сообщений: 327
Регистрация: 24-06-06
Из: Томск
Пользователь №: 18 328



Цитата(demiurg_spb @ Aug 14 2012, 17:04) *
Аналогично.
Но как-то ИМХО жалко для производства JTAG-ICE использовать...
У нас используется аналог stk200 с нормальным мягеньким шлейфиком. И всё-равно иногда приходится его переобжимать и менять из-за сильного использования.
Мне кажется что JTAG-ICE тоже долго не протянет.

Да был у нас другой. Сгорел вчера. Надо как-то перекантоваться.
Go to the top of the page
 
+Quote Post
_Артём_
сообщение Aug 14 2012, 11:06
Сообщение #6


Гуру
******

Группа: Свой
Сообщений: 2 128
Регистрация: 21-05-06
Пользователь №: 17 322



Цитата(shreck @ Aug 14 2012, 11:23) *
Есть atmel'овское изделие AVR JTAGICE MKII. Нужна удобная программа (можно гуевую, можно консольную) для прошивки своих изделий при производстве. Чем можно воспользоватья?

А чем не устраивает jtagiceii.exe из AVRStudio?
Go to the top of the page
 
+Quote Post
ArtemKAD
сообщение Aug 14 2012, 11:42
Сообщение #7


Профессионал
*****

Группа: Свой
Сообщений: 1 508
Регистрация: 26-06-06
Из: Киев
Пользователь №: 18 364



У 5.1 студии есть консольная atprogram.exe . Или в самой студии, что при производстве ИМХО - изврат...
Go to the top of the page
 
+Quote Post
kolobok0
сообщение Aug 14 2012, 12:25
Сообщение #8


практикующий тех. волшебник
*****

Группа: Участник
Сообщений: 1 190
Регистрация: 9-09-05
Пользователь №: 8 417



Цитата(shreck @ Aug 14 2012, 12:23) *
...Нужна удобная программа (можно гуевую, можно консольную)...


дык вроде в умной книжечке от атмэля, вместе с JTAG, вроде как были примеры консольного запуска???
Go to the top of the page
 
+Quote Post
_Артём_
сообщение Aug 14 2012, 12:33
Сообщение #9


Гуру
******

Группа: Свой
Сообщений: 2 128
Регистрация: 21-05-06
Пользователь №: 17 322



Цитата(kolobok0 @ Aug 14 2012, 15:25) *
дык вроде в умной книжечке от атмэля, вместе с JTAG, вроде как были примеры консольного запуска???

Есть там консольная прграмма и для JTAG и для AVRISP. И они вполне работают.
Go to the top of the page
 
+Quote Post
demiurg_spb
сообщение Aug 14 2012, 13:34
Сообщение #10


неотягощённый злом
******

Группа: Свой
Сообщений: 2 746
Регистрация: 31-01-08
Из: Санкт-Петербург
Пользователь №: 34 643



Цитата(_Артём_ @ Aug 14 2012, 15:06) *
А чем не устраивает jtagiceii.exe из AVRStudio?
Думаю не единообразностью.
AvrDude работает фактически со всеми программаторами.
Изучил её одну как отче наш и шуруешь уже по накатанной:-)
Думаю что и из под linux'a тоже.


--------------------
“Будьте внимательны к своим мыслям - они начало поступков” (Лао-Цзы)
Go to the top of the page
 
+Quote Post
_Артём_
сообщение Aug 14 2012, 13:40
Сообщение #11


Гуру
******

Группа: Свой
Сообщений: 2 128
Регистрация: 21-05-06
Пользователь №: 17 322



Цитата(demiurg_spb @ Aug 14 2012, 16:34) *
Думаю не единообразностью.

Да, есть такое дело.
Цитата(demiurg_spb @ Aug 14 2012, 16:34) *
AvrDude работает фактически со всеми программаторами.

И JTAG и ISP есть? По возможностям и надёжности не хуже, чем атмеловское?
Go to the top of the page
 
+Quote Post
shreck
сообщение Aug 14 2012, 13:42
Сообщение #12


Местный
***

Группа: Свой
Сообщений: 327
Регистрация: 24-06-06
Из: Томск
Пользователь №: 18 328



Цитата(_Артём_ @ Aug 14 2012, 18:06) *
А чем не устраивает jtagiceii.exe из AVRStudio?

Все равно. Хоть avrdude, хоть jtagiceii. Вот только AVRStudio качать, устанавливать совсем не хочется.

Цитата(_Артём_ @ Aug 14 2012, 19:33) *
Есть там консольная прграмма и для JTAG и для AVRISP. И они вполне работают.

Вы это о чем?
Go to the top of the page
 
+Quote Post
_Артём_
сообщение Aug 14 2012, 13:59
Сообщение #13


Гуру
******

Группа: Свой
Сообщений: 2 128
Регистрация: 21-05-06
Пользователь №: 17 322



Цитата(shreck @ Aug 14 2012, 16:42) *
Вы это о чем?

Программировать можно запуская bat-файл.
Типа такого (зашить фузы):
Цитата
jtagiceii.exe -d ATmega128 -mi -I125000 -e -f 0xD2BF -E 0xFF

Или не через бат-файл, а запускать своей программой и получать от неё стандартный поток.
Go to the top of the page
 
+Quote Post
demiurg_spb
сообщение Aug 14 2012, 19:37
Сообщение #14


неотягощённый злом
******

Группа: Свой
Сообщений: 2 746
Регистрация: 31-01-08
Из: Санкт-Петербург
Пользователь №: 34 643



Цитата(_Артём_ @ Aug 14 2012, 17:40) *
И JTAG и ISP есть?
Есть.
Для одного Atmel JTAG ICE mkII вон сколько вариантов (а всего более 50):
jtag2dw = Atmel JTAG ICE mkII in debugWire mode
jtag2isp = Atmel JTAG ICE mkII in ISP mode
jtag2 = Atmel JTAG ICE mkII
jtag2fast = Atmel JTAG ICE mkII
jtag2slow = Atmel JTAG ICE mkII
jtagmkII = Atmel JTAG ICE mkII
Цитата
По возможностям и надёжности не хуже, чем атмеловское?
Я не сравнивал, но всё работает, да и если что, разработчик дьюда готов идти на контакт.


--------------------
“Будьте внимательны к своим мыслям - они начало поступков” (Лао-Цзы)
Go to the top of the page
 
+Quote Post
_Артём_
сообщение Aug 15 2012, 11:45
Сообщение #15


Гуру
******

Группа: Свой
Сообщений: 2 128
Регистрация: 21-05-06
Пользователь №: 17 322



Цитата(demiurg_spb @ Aug 14 2012, 22:37) *
Есть.
Для одного Atmel JTAG ICE mkII вон сколько вариантов (а всего более 50):

Спасибо.
Может и стоит его использовать: средства от Атмела очень уж различаются по входным и выходным форматам, может тут единообразней.
Go to the top of the page
 
+Quote Post

2 страниц V   1 2 >
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 19th July 2025 - 02:33
Рейтинг@Mail.ru


Страница сгенерированна за 0.01494 секунд с 7
ELECTRONIX ©2004-2016